What’s the average condo selling time in Mississauga?



Want to Know How Fast Condos Actually Sell in Mississauga? The Answer Might Surprise You.

Quick answer: average condo selling time in Mississauga

Most condos in Mississauga sell in roughly 15–35 days on market (DOM) when priced and marketed correctly. In hot months it can be under 10–14 days. In slower seasons or for overpriced units, DOM can stretch to 45–90+ days. That range comes from local MLS trends, CREA patterns, and recent Mississauga condo sales analysis.

Why that range matters for your sale

Days on market isn’t a vanity metric. It directly affects final sale price, negotiating power, and buyer perception. A fast sale signals demand and often nets a better price. A long listing signals problems: price, condition, or presentation.

Data-driven breakdown

    • Hot market (high demand): average 7–14 days. Expect multiple offers and price growth.
    • Balanced market: average 15–35 days. Reasonable pricing and strong marketing win.
    • Buyer market (lower demand): 35–90+ days. Price cuts and incentives become common.

Local variables that change the DOM:

    • Building age and amenities
    • Unit size and layout
    • Floor and view
    • Maintenance fees
    • Proximity to Square One, transit, GO stations
    • Recent comparable sales in the same building

Action plan to sell a condo fast in Mississauga

    • Price for action, not ego. Start 3–5% below the top comps to generate offers in a balanced market. Buyers compare on price first. Be aggressive when you want speed.
    • Professional photos and 3D tour. Listings with pro photos get far more clicks. Invest $200–$500—return is immediate.
    • Stage to sell. Minimal cost staging reduces DOM by showing lifestyle and space. Rent furniture or declutter.
    • Market to the right buyers. Target investors, first-time buyers, and commuters. Use social ads, targeted email blasts, and MLS featured placements.
    • Flexible showings & quick responses. The first 7–10 days drive activity. Be ready.
    • Pre-listing inspection and condo docs. Remove objections early. Saves time during offers.
    • Use an expert agent who knows Mississauga condo buyers and building rules.
